Foothills Christian Schools - Junior/Senior High School

Foothills Christian Schools

4.6

Foothills Christian Schools serves the entire East County region including Santee with a comprehensive Christian education program. The junior/senior high campus features rigorous college preparatory curriculum with AP courses, competitive athletics programs, and extensive arts education. The school maintains small class sizes with a student-teacher ratio of 14:1 and emphasizes character development alongside academic excellence. Facilities include modern science labs, performing arts spaces, and athletic fields serving students from Santee and surrounding communities.

Christian Unified Schools of San Diego - East County

Christian Unified Schools of San Diego

4.4

Serving Santee and East County families, Christian Unified Schools provides a classical Christian education from preschool through high school. The East County campus offers a comprehensive academic program with strong emphasis on critical thinking, classical literature, and STEM education. The school features dedicated science labs, technology-integrated classrooms, and competitive athletic programs. With a focus on developing well-rounded students, the school offers extensive extracurricular activities including music, drama, and community service opportunities.

The Rock Academy

The Rock Church

4.3

The Rock Academy serves students from throughout San Diego County including Santee with a comprehensive Christian education program. The school offers rigorous college preparatory curriculum with AP courses, dual enrollment opportunities, and career technical education pathways. Notable programs include extensive performing arts offerings, competitive athletics, and mission trip opportunities. The campus features modern classrooms, science laboratories, performance venues, and athletic facilities. Transportation options are available for Santee-area families seeking a faith-based educational environment.

How does tuition for private schools in Santee, CA, compare to the state average, and what financial aid options are typically available?

Tuition for Santee-area private schools is generally competitive with or slightly below the average for California private schools, which is approximately $15,000-$20,000+ annually for K-12. For the 2024-2025 academic year, tuition at local schools like Foothills Christian and Christian Unified typically ranges from $8,000 to $12,000 for elementary grades and up to $15,000 for high school. Importantly, California does not have a statewide voucher program, but all major private schools in Santee offer need-based financial aid and scholarships. Additionally, many families utilize the California Tax Credit Scholarship program, administered by organizations like ACE Scholarships, which can provide significant tuition assistance based on income eligibility.

What is the typical enrollment timeline and process for private schools in Santee, and are there waitlists?

The enrollment process for Santee private schools typically begins in the fall (October-January) for the following academic year, with priority application deadlines often set by February. The process usually involves a submitted application, family interview, student assessment or shadow day, and submission of past academic records. Due to the limited number of seats, especially in popular elementary grades, waitlists are common at the most sought-after schools. A key local consideration is that many Santee families apply to multiple schools in East County simultaneously. It is highly recommended to initiate inquiries at least a year in advance, and many schools host open houses in the fall, which are essential for prospective families to attend.

For families considering both, what are the key differences between Santee's public school district (Santee School District and Grossmont Union High School District) and its private school options?

The most pronounced differences lie in class size, curriculum flexibility, and religious education. Santee's public schools are well-regarded and tuition-free, but private schools offer significantly smaller class sizes (often 15-20 students vs. 25-35+ in public). The private schools in Santee provide a curriculum mandated with religious integration, which is not an option in public schools. Academically, private schools like Foothills Christian offer a defined college-prep track, while public high schools (like West Hills High) offer a broader array of elective pathways, including career technical education (CTE). Extracurricular opportunities in public schools are often larger in scale due to bigger student populations. The decision often hinges on a family's desire for a specific faith-based environment and personalized attention versus the comprehensive, tax-supported public system.
